Jaden Korr is a Force-sensitive, born around 1 ABY, who spent his childhood on the galactic capital of Coruscant. While living with his adoptive Uncle Orn, Korr was guided by the Force to construct a working lightsaber in 14 ABY, an achievement that earned him a place at Jedi Master Luke Skywalker's Jedi Praxeum on the moon of Yavin 4. On his way there, aboard the shuttle Yavin Runner II, Korr met and befriended a fellow recruit, Rosh Penin. Assigned as an apprentice to Jedi Master Kyle Katarn, Korr spent much of his training fighting a newly emerged dark side cult called the Disciples of Ragnos. Utilizing a Sith artifact called the Scepter of Ragnos, the leader of the cult, Tavion Axmis, used it to siphon Force energy from places with powerful Force auras. She then intended to release the contained power to resurrect an ancient Sith Lord, Marka Ragnos. Korr undertook multiple missions throughout the galaxy, foiling the cult's plans as best as he could. During the mission to the planet Vjun, Korr discovered that Penin had fallen to the Dark Side of the Force and had joined the Disciples. After escaping from Vjun, Korr was promoted by Skywalker to the rank of Jedi Knight, and he continued his fight against the cultists and their Imperial Remnant allies. Eventually, Korr successfully brought Penin back from the Dark Side and defeated Axmis on the Sith world of Korriban, stopping the Disciples of Ragnos.

Back to the topic. First of all, thanks for mentioning the work we made together with @@Zionter, really nice to hear this after 4 years since the initial release.

Second, I tried to resurrect SkyLine project like 3 times, but, sadly, none of these attempts have been successful.

 

2013.

It was the first time I started designing the v2. In a year I got all of finished yet not shown work erased because of HDD failure.

[see the 2013 concept]

 

2015.

Started again from scratch, this time the concept were simpler and prettier, as for me. Minimalism era.

My second attempt failed because I got no time to continue the design and prototyping process. So again I shelved it 'till I got the time and desire to continue.

[see the early 2015 concept]

[see the late 'Hoth' 2015 concept]

 

2016.

Got contacted by @ and was asked about possibility of using of some assets from the concepts I made. I agreed and proposed to continue the creating process of SkyLine by the team he were in (they got designer, coder and a bunch of other guys and I was alone with no coding/menu writing skills).

In SkyLine 2.0 we tried to change the gamecode to get the game's GUI look like the concepts I've made. Didn't work as I wanted and we paused it (kinda hard to adapt it to every external modification).
